Визуализация данных в электронных таблицах часто требует использования дополнительных графических элементов, чтобы читатель мог мгновенно считать тренд или направление изменения показателей. Одним из самых востребованных инструментов для этой цели является стрелка, которая может указывать на рост, падение или стабильность значений. Пользователи часто ищут способ, как в Excel сделать стрелку в ячейке, чтобы улучшить восприятие отчетов, дашбордов и финансовых сводок без использования громоздких диаграмм.
Существует несколько проверенных методов реализации этой задачи, каждый из которых имеет свои преимущества в зависимости от конечной цели. Вы можете использовать статические символы Юникода, специальные шрифты, условное форматирование для динамических индикаторов или даже рисованные объекты для сложных схем. Выбор правильного подхода зависит от того, нужна ли вам статичная картинка или умный индикатор, реагирующий на изменение цифр.
В этой статье мы подробно разберем все доступные техники, от простых вставок символов до создания автоматизированных систем визуализации с помощью формул. Вы научитесь управлять направлением и цветом указателей, что сделает ваши таблицы профессиональными и легко читаемыми. Давайте рассмотрим пошагово каждый метод, чтобы вы могли выбрать наиболее подходящий для вашего случая.
Использование встроенных символов и вставка объектов
Самый простой способ добавить статический указатель направления — воспользоваться стандартной функцией вставки символов. Этот метод идеально подходит, когда вам нужно разово оформить ячейку и в дальнейшем не планируется автоматическое изменение направления стрелки. Для этого перейдите на вкладку Вставка и выберите кнопку Символ в правой части ленты инструментов.
В открывшемся окне в поле "Набор" необходимо выбрать опцию Юникод (hex) или просто прокрутить список до раздела "Стрелки". Здесь вы найдете множество вариантов: от тонких линий до жирных треугольников и изогнутых указателей. Код символа может варьироваться, но для стандартных стрелок чаще всего используется диапазон от 2190 до 2199.
Альтернативный быстрый способ — использование сочетания клавиш для ввода кода символа напрямую. Если вы зажмете клавишу Alt и наберете на цифровой клавиатуре код, например, 2193, а затем отпустите Alt, в ячейке появится соответствующая стрелка. Этот метод требует знания кодов, но значительно ускоряет процесс работы при частом использовании.
- ➡️ Откройте вкладку "Вставка" и нажмите "Символ" для доступа к полной библиотеке знаков.
- ⬇️ Используйте коды Юникода (например, 2193) в сочетании с Alt для быстрого ввода.
- ⬆️ Копируйте готовые символы из таблицы и вставляйте их в нужные ячейки для единообразия.
- ⬅️ Меняйте цвет шрифта, чтобы стрелка гармонично вписывалась в дизайн вашей таблицы.
⚠️ Внимание: Символы, вставленные через меню "Символ", являются статическими. Они не изменят свое направление автоматически, если изменятся данные в соседних ячейках, поэтому этот метод не подходит для динамических отчетов.
Помимо символов шрифта, можно использовать графические объекты из вкладки Фигуры. Нарисовав стрелку, вы можете свободно перемещать ее, вращать и изменять размер, однако такие объекты "плавают" над ячейками и не привязаны жестко к содержимому клетки, что может создать проблемы при сортировке или фильтрации данных.
Применение шрифтов Wingdings и Webdings
Одним из самых популярных и гибких методов, позволяющих как в Excel сделать стрелку в ячейке динамически, является использование специальных шрифтов, таких как Wingdings 3. В отличие от обычных символов, здесь каждому знаку алфавита соответствует определенная графическая фигура, что позволяет управлять внешним видом ячейки, просто меняя букву.
Для реализации этого метода выделите целевую ячейку или диапазон и в поле выбора шрифта впишите Wingdings 3. После этого ввод обычных букв превратится в стрелки: например, буква "p" станет стрелкой вверх, а "q" — стрелкой вниз. Это дает возможность использовать формулы для автоматической замены букв в зависимости от условий.
Существует множество вариаций шрифтов, включая стандартные Wingdings и Webdings, которые содержат свои наборы пиктограмм. В Wingdings 3 особенно богатый выбор индикаторов: одинарные, двойные, закрашенные и контурные стрелки, что позволяет создавать сложные системы визуальной навигации внутри документа.
Главное преимущество этого подхода заключается в том, что стрелка становится частью текстового содержимого ячейки. Вы можете комбинировать ее с числами или текстом, применять к ней форматирование цвета и жирности, а также использовать в формулах для конкатенации.
Автоматизация через условное форматирование
Наиболее профессиональным решением для аналитических отчетов является использование условного форматирования. Этот инструмент позволяет автоматически менять символ в ячейке в зависимости от значения, которое в ней находится или в соседней клетке. Например, если продажи выросли — появляется зеленая стрелка вверх, если упали — красная вниз.
Для настройки этого механизма перейдите на вкладку Главная и выберите Условное форматирование → Наборы значков. Excel предложит готовые наборы, включающие стрелки, светофоры и флаги. Система сама распределит значения по диапазонам, но вы можете настроить пороги вручную, выбрав пункт Управление правилами.
В окне управления правилами можно задать конкретные значения для переключения индикаторов. Например, установить условие: если значение больше 0, то зеленая стрелка; если равно 0 — желтая горизонтальная; если меньше 0 — красная вниз. Это создает мощный инструмент визуального контроля без написания сложного кода.
☑️ Настройка индикаторов тренда
Важно отметить, что при использовании наборов значков сам символ не отображается в строке формул, он является исключительно визуальным слоем. Если вам нужно, чтобы стрелка участвовала в дальнейших вычислениях или экспортировалась в другие системы как текст, этот метод может не подойти, и тогда лучше использовать формулы.
Создание динамических стрелок с помощью формул
Для продвинутых пользователей, которым требуется максимальная гибкость, идеально подойдет комбинация функций и шрифта Wingdings 3. Используя логическую функцию ЕСЛИ (или IF в английской версии), можно заставить Excel самостоятельно выбирать необходимую букву, которая при определенном шрифте превратится в нужную стрелку.
Представьте, что в ячейке A1 у вас находится текущий показатель, а в B1 — предыдущий. В ячейке C1 вы можете прописать формулу, которая сравнит эти значения. Если A1 больше B1, формула вернет букву, соответствующую стрелке вверх, если меньше — стрелке вниз. Затем на ячейку C1 применяется шрифт Wingdings 3.
Пример формулы может выглядеть следующим образом:
=ЕСЛИ(A1>B1; "p"; ЕСЛИ(A1
В данном случае "p" даст стрелку вверх, "q" — вниз, а "n" — горизонтальную (в шрифте Wingdings 3). Комбинируя это с функциями ЦЕЛОЕ или ОКРУГЛ, можно создавать сложные индикаторы состояния.
Секретные коды для формул
В шрифте Wingdings 3: p = вверх, q = вниз, n = вправо, o = влево, r = двойная вверх, s = двойная вниз. Запомнив эти соответствия, вы сможете конструировать любые логические цепочки.
Такой подход позволяет создавать полностью автономные дашборды, где визуальная часть полностью зависит от данных. Изменяя исходные цифры, пользователь мгновенно видит изменение графического индикатора, что критически важно для оперативного принятия решений.
Сравнение методов визуализации
Выбор конкретного способа зависит от задач, которые стоят перед вами. Чтобы помочь вам определиться, мы подготовили сравнительную таблицу основных характеристик каждого метода. Она поможет взвесить все "за" и "против" перед началом оформления документа.
| Метод | Динамичность | Сложность настройки | Влияние на вес файла |
|---|---|---|---|
| Символы Юникода | Нет (статика) | Низкая | Минимальное |
| Шрифт Wingdings | Да (с формулами) | Средняя | Минимальное |
| Условное форматирование | Да (автоматически) | Средняя | Низкое |
| Фигуры (рисование) | Нет (статика) | Высокая | Среднее/Высокое |
Как видно из таблицы, для разовых отчетов проще всего использовать символы, а для постоянных мониторинговых таблиц лучше всего подходит условное форматирование или формулы. Вес файла также имеет значение, если вы работаете с огромными массивами данных на слабых компьютерах.
⚠️ Внимание: При использовании шрифтов Wingdings убедитесь, что файл будет открываться на устройстве, где эти шрифты установлены. Хотя они являются стандартными для Windows, на некоторых мобильных устройствах или в веб-версиях Excel отображение может нарушиться.
Частые ошибки и советы по оформлению
При работе с графическими элементами в таблицах легко допустить ошибки, которые ухудшат восприятие информации. Одна из распространенных проблем — использование слишком мелких или бледных стрелок, которые теряются на общем фоне. Всегда проверяйте контрастность цветов.
Еще одна ошибка — смешивание разных стилей стрелок в одном отчете. Если вы начали использовать жирные закрашенные треугольники, не стоит вдруг переходить на тонкие контурные линии. Единообразие стиля — ключ к профессиональному виду документа.
Также стоит учитывать, что при печати таблицы в черно-белом режиме цветные индикаторы могут стать неразличимыми. В таких случаях рекомендуется использовать разные формы стрелок (например, полные и пустые) или добавлять текстовые пояснения рядом с графическими элементами.
FAQ: Часто задаваемые вопросы
Как сделать так, чтобы стрелка меняла цвет автоматически?
Для этого используйте инструмент "Условное форматирование". Выберите диапазон, нажмите "Создать правило", выберите "Форматировать только ячейки, которые содержат" и задайте условия (например, больше 0). В формате укажите зеленый цвет шрифта. Повторите для отрицательных значений с красным цветом.
Почему вместо стрелки у меня отображается буква или квадратик?
Скорее всего, для ячейки не выбран правильный шрифт. Если вы использовали коды Wingdings, убедитесь, что в поле шрифта выбрано Wingdings 3. Если использовался Юникод, возможно, ваш текущий шрифт не поддерживает этот символ, попробуйте изменить шрифт на Segoe UI Symbol или Arial.
Можно ли вставить стрелку с помощью горячих клавиш?
Да, если у вас есть цифровая клавиатура. Зажмите Alt и наберите код символа (например, 2190 для стрелки влево), затем отпустите Alt. Также можно настроить макросы или автозамену для часто используемых символов.
Как удалить все стрелки из таблицы быстро?
Если стрелки вставлены как текст, используйте "Найти и заменить" (Ctrl+H). В поле "Найти" вставьте символ стрелки (можно скопировать из любой ячейки), поле "Заменить на" оставьте пустым и нажмите "Заменить все". Если это условное форматирование, очистите правила через меню условного форматирования.